Vendor Notes
This Spring 2021 raw Pu-erh from Fa Zhan He offers a delightful introduction to the world of Pu-erh with its remarkably smooth character. Expect a pleasing floral fragrance, a decently thick soup, and a satisfying mouthfeel that invites continuous sipping. It's an approachable and balanced tea, devoid of harsh bitterness, making it an excellent choice for daily enjoyment.

How should I brew Spring 2021 Fa Zhan He?
Water around 95–100 °C (203–212 °F). In a mug, steep 3–5 min. For gongfu, use 5–7 g per 100 ml, 10–20 s steeps (10–20+ rounds). You'll get to see how the flavor changes across multiple rounds. Rinse the leaves once with boiling water before your first real steep. It cleans off storage dust and gets the flavor going.
